KDrew Dances On the Edge of Sanity In Stunning New Single, "Hysteria"

Bridging the chasm between euphoria and despair, KDrew dissects the human condition in his new single, “Hysteria.”

Out now via Hegemon Select, the melodic bass track pulsates like a feverish heartbeat, its thunderous kickdrums intertwining with haunting melodies to mirror the frantic energy of its title. As the song’s propulsive arrangement progresses, you can’t help but be swept away by the sheer force of KDrew’s cinematic production.

Meanwhile, his powerful vocals explore temporal dissonance, framing a mental snapshot of someone caught between past mistakes and an uncertain future. With the precision of a surgeon and the soul of a tortured poet, his words evoke a sense of urgency, inviting us to confront our own demons in a world of unrelenting change. “We’re lost in the waste of two different places / When we wake up, new generation / Where we go through the pages of all our mistakes before all our time is up,” he croons.

That theme is masterfully echoed in the song’s drops, where a latticework of frenetic plucks and growling neuro-bass creates a sense of being suspended between two worlds. To that end, “Hysteria” is more of a primal scream than a song, speaking to the collective anxiety of a generation and distilling it into two and a half minutes of unfiltered emotion.
